Zk-SNARK is an acronym that stands
Zero-knowledge non-interactive argument”. Zk-SNARK is a cryptographic proof that allows one party to prove that they have certain information. This proof was made possible by a secret key generated before the operation. It is used as part of the protocol for
Zk-SNARK is a zero-knowledge proof iraq whatsapp number data protocol used in encryption and is an. Acronym for “Zero Knowledge Non-Interactive Knowledge of Zero Knowledge”.
This argument was first developed and implemented in the late 1980s, and is now. Used in the cryptocurrency Zcash to solve the problem of anonymity with Bitcoin-like blockchains.
Zk-SNARK proofs are based on establishing an initial “belief system” that has been evaluated as a security flaw.
An understanding of Zk-SNARK
For many early members of the cryptocurrency community, primarily the Bitcoin community. Privacy was the goal and hallmark However. Given the need for cryptocurrency to create a “trustless” system that. Guarantees the integrity of electronic currency and digital transactions, privacy has always been a secondary concern.
In the early 2010s, redefining people proved impossible, but relatively easy. Due to the lack of privacy of some of the original cryptocurrencies such as Bitcoin, developers have started working on privacy-oriented coins. The most notable was that Zcash supported the technology known as ZK-SNARKs.
Zero proof of knowledge
A ZK-Snark (“zero knowledge and non-interactive proof of small volume”) uses the concept known as “zero-knowledge proof.” The idea behind these arguments was first developed in the 1980s. Simply put, zero knowledge is a situation where two parties to a transaction can each verify a certain set of information about themselves, without revealing what that information is.
For most other types of evidence, at least when you click on something one of the two parties must have access to all information. Traditional authentication can be compared to a password used to access a network. The user sends the password, and the network itself checks the content of the password and verifies its correctness. For this, the content of the password must be accessible on the network.
The Zk-SNARK
A version of knowledge proof in this case consists in showing to the network (through mathematical proof) that the user has the correct password without revealing the password itself. In this case, the advantages of privacy and security are obvious: if there is no storage of the password on the network for verification purposes, the password cannot be stolen.
The mathematical basis of Zk-SNARKS is complex. Nevertheless, this type of evidence allows one party to show not only that certain information betting data exists, but also that the party in question is aware of that information. In the case of Zcash, zk-SNARK can be verified instantly, and the protocol does not require interaction between the provider and the validator.
Of course, there are concerns about zk-SNARK.
For example, if someone gets access to the private key used to create the This allows a person to create new Zcash tokens by creating counterfeit money. To avoid this, Zcash was designed to process and distribute proof-of-concept protocols to multiple parties.
Although the construction of Zcash’s proof-of-concept process has been completed in a way that reduces the possibility of token forgery through false proofs, there is another problem with the cryptocurrency. Zcash was created out of a 20% “tax” levied on all blocks created in the token’s first few years. This tax is called “founders tax” and it is used to compensate the developers of cryptocurrency.